How to prepare for a job interview at Elliot Marsh

✨Know the School's Vision

Before your interview, take some time to research the education trust and its schools. Understand their mission and values, especially their commitment to putting children first. This will help you align your answers with their goals and show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

As an Assistant Headteacher, you'll likely face scenario-based questions. Think about past experiences where you've successfully handled challenges in a school setting. Prepare specific examples that highlight your leadership skills, problem-solving abilities, and how you foster a positive learning environment.

✨Showcase Your Leadership Style

Be ready to discuss your leadership philosophy and how it aligns with the school's approach. Share examples of how you've motivated staff, engaged with parents, and supported students. This will demonstrate your capability to lead effectively within their educational framework.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ask thoughtful questions. Inquire about the school's current initiatives, challenges they face, or how they measure success.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if the school is the right fit for you.
